Description

Gold mesh purse
MFA# 1999.489

Any fabric with open spaces between the yarn or wire. A mesh fabric may be knit, woven, or knotted. Wire mesh is used for screening.

Synonyms and Related Terms

screen; netting; tejido de malla (Esp.); netwerk (Ned);
